Pug Dog Breed
The Pug is a sturdy dog, but short with males measuring 12-15 inches tall and weighing between 14 and 20 pounds, and the female is a bitch 8-12 inches tall with a weight of 13-18 pounds. They have a round head which is disproportionately large for its body size, with a square muzzle that is blunt and it very small. Their ears may be in the form of button or a rose, and are small and thin. The tail curls over his back and is most commonly a double loop with a short coat that is thin and soft. There can be a variety of colors such as black, silver apricot fawn. While these dogs are small they are surprisingly strong and muscular.
History. The Pug is a very ancient breed of dog, believed to have originated before 400 BC. Although there is much discussion about the exact origin is generally accepted that originated in Asia. Dogs often used to stay in monasteries, and were the favorites of the different copyrights. Pugs were first introduced to Europe late 18th century by merchants and crews of the trading company of the Dutch East India. In the 19th century, who came to the United States and were recognized as a race in 1885.
Temperament. The Pugs are not yappy dogs but they make excellent watchdogs, drawing attention to their owners detect everything that is unusual. They are strong-willed, but usually friendly and it is rare to be aggressive. They are well suited as a family pet and get along well with children, also are the strong enough and durable enough to withstand play with younger children, whose size is not a problem, since they are not large enough to hit young children in general. They are not normally particularly excitable dogs, but rarely boring. Also integrate well with other pets in the home. Health. Pugs can get cold quite easily and especially not tolerate hot or cold weather. Because of its snout short, are more prone to respiratory problems. It is also prone to skin diseases and a condition called pug dog encephalitis, an infection cerebral base. It is common for women when they give birth to require a caesarean section, largely due to the size of the baby's head. They may also suffer from some diseases eyes, and it is important not to feed more than a pug they will eat more than you require will lead to obesity.
